Initial commit: API gateway with admin console

- FastAPI async gateway with httpx proxying to multiple upstreams
- SQLite database with SQLAlchemy ORM
- Admin console: manage services, users, API keys, endpoint access
- Per-key, per-endpoint granular access control
- OpenAPI document sync and caching (5-minute TTL)
- Request/response logging with full transaction inspection
- In-memory rate limiting (per-key, fixed-window)
- Tiered log retention (7d payloads, 90d rows, incremental vacuum)
- TLS verification toggle per service (for self-signed certificates)
- Service connectivity validation with automatic endpoint refresh
- Request browser with filters and deep-link inspection
- Docker setup with persistent volume
- Modal forms for create/edit flows
